adv

Etymology: Etymology tree English devious Middle English -ly English -ly English deviously From devious + -ly.

  1. In a devious manner.

    Shirley worked deviously, of course. Having, under a name not her own, achieved fame by Tarbellizing the plutocrat in a book, and having (still in disguise) been given by the simple minded great man command of his most private papers […]

    And what conversation becomes then is a sustained strip or tract of referencings, each referencing tending to bear, but often deviously, some retrospectively perceivable connection to the immediately preceding one.
